Lately I haven't been able to find many old places to detect at (although I just did get permission to hunt a house built in 1833 (which I plan on doing later this week)). So I decided to try a little experiment at a local elem school. I was hunting the mulch area was having no luck, so I assumed someone else hunted it recently. So I went to the grassy area and hunted until I found a quarter with some good dirt on it and switched to the probe on the machine and then to the 'Learn' function on it and programmed the quarter into it so that it would only beep when it found a quarter. I did find a few dimes with this setting, but they ring up almost identical. I also dug a few sounds that I knew weren't quarters, but I just wanted to test them out because they were near the quarter range, but not quite there, and they were trash everytime. I ended up digging 23 quarters. 4 of those quarters went to 4 little kids who were following me around the whole time. I also dug a local bus token. I think whenever I don't have any new places to hunt I will just program a quarter in and go clean up the quarters out of every place.
